Default Help!! No spark

My 1990 big bear was running perfect the other day and then just stalled. I started it again drove a bit and stalled again and would not start so I towed it home and now no spark. I.can't figure put what's wrong all lights come on but will not give spark. Any help is greatly appreciated.

check the kill and ignition switch's with meter, if good checks three prong stator plug with ohs meter as well.my stator has .06 ohs on all three pins.three white wires on rectifier need to be checked as well.
